Equipment Rack Installation
The M-100 rack mount kit is ordered separately and can be used to mount the M-100 on a 2-
post or 4-post 19” rack.
The following safety guidelines apply to rack installation:
• Elevated ambient operating temperature—If the M-100 is installed in a closed or multi-
unit rack assembly, the ambient operating temperature of the rack environment may be
greater than the ambient room temperature. Verify that the ambient temperature of the
rack assembly meets the maximum rated ambient temperature requirements listed in
“Environmental Specifications” on page 20.
• Reduced air flow—Ensure that the airflow required for safe device operation is not
compromised by the rack installation.
• Mechanical loading—Ensure that the rack-mounted device does not cause hazardous
conditions due to uneven mechanical loading.
• Circuit overloading—Ensure that the circuit that supplies power to the device is
sufficiently rated to avoid circuit overloading or excess load on supply wiring. Refer to
“Electrical Specifications” on page 20.
• Reliable earthing—Maintain reliable earthing of rack mounted equipment. Pay special
attention to supply connections other than direct connections to the branch circuit (such
as the use of power strips).
